On this flavored & mouthwatering experience, you’ll get to taste:
- Moroccan coconut Macaroons, kids’ favorite sweet treat
- The original chicken & almond Pastilla, a savory pie reserved for weddings & family get-togethers
- Yummy local pastries (Briwate, Ghriyba, ..) in one of the city’s oldest bakeries
- Traditional Harira soup, accompanied by dates and Chebbakiya (Honey desert rose), like how most locals break their fast during the holy month of Ramadan
- Babbouche (Moroccan snails) slowly cooked in an aromatic herbal-infused broth
- Authentic mint tea & Msemmen (Moroccan pancakes), a delicious pan-fried dough, typically spread with honey and cheese
- Fakya, a mix of dried fruits and nuts that is carefully prepared and commonly shared among families & friends during celebrations
- Signature olives of Morocco, from the greens with their creamy smooth texture to the reds tossed in parsley and cilantro
Dinner is served at a local restaurant: fresh Moroccan salad + main Tajine (many options available). The portions are generous, the food is wholesome & the Tajines are scrumptious!
For dessert, we offer you Raïb, an absolutely divine and very popular homemade yogurt. Bon appétit!
